WebRatite Facts . Ratites are a diverse group of flightless and mostly large and long-legged birds. Australia, Africa and South American all host species of ratites. ... Emu . Scientific name: Dromaius novaeollandiae. Facts. Range: Australia, New Guinea, Indonesia, Solomon Islands, and Philippines Life Span: 10-20 years (captivity) 35 years (wild) ... Webratite noun rat· ite ˈra-ˌtīt : a bird with a flat breastbone especially : any of various mostly flightless birds (such as an ostrich, rhea, emu, moa, or kiwi) with small or rudimentary wings and no keel on the sternum that are probably of polyphyletic origin and are assigned to a number of different orders ratite adjective Example Sentences

WebFeb 6, 2024 · The largest birds living today, the African ostrich and the Australian emu, are ratites.
